Ohanaeze Ndigbo has named 2027 Consensus Presidential Candidate.

 

NewsOnline Nigeria reports that the apex Igbo socio-cultural organization, Ohanaeze Ndigbo, has announced its decision to adopt President Bola Tinubu as the sole consensus candidate for the 2027 presidential election.

 

The bold announcement follows extensive consultations with key stakeholders across the South-East region, including governors, traditional rulers, religious leaders, and representatives from youth, women’s groups, and civil society organizations.

 

According to a statement signed by Ohanaeze Ndigbo’s Deputy President, Mazi Okechukwu Isiguzoro, and National Spokesperson, Chief Thompson Ohia, the formal declaration is set to take place on May 23, 2025, coinciding with President Tinubu’s visit to Abia State, a stronghold of Nigeria’s opposition Labour Party.

The statement reads: “This historic consensus has been meticulously cultivated through extensive consultations with a diverse array of key stakeholders, including South-East governors, revered traditional rulers, esteemed religious leaders, and representatives from various youth and women’s groups, as well as civil society organisations across our region.

 

“The collective decision reached by Ohanaeze Ndigbo and South-East stakeholders marks a departure from historical precedence and signifies a resolute intent to align with the mainstream national leadership under President Tinubu. It heralds the official end of the South-East’s longstanding affiliation with opposition parties such as the PDP, APGA, and LP—a decisive step towards a reorientation, concluding an era of opposition from 2015 to 2025 and transitioning into collaboration with the APC.

“In this spirit of unity and progress, Ohanaeze Ndigbo and South-East stakeholders have appointed Senator David Umahi, the distinguished Minister of Works and former Chairman of South-East Governors’ Forum, to serve as the lead coordinator for President Tinubu’s campaign across the South-East. Senator Umahi’s proven leadership and unwavering commitment to development make him the ideal candidate for this crucial role. Ohanaeze expresses full confidence in his ability to mobilise support, foster cooperation, and deliver a resounding victory for President Tinubu in the upcoming election.

 

“Furthermore, we emphasise that any coalition of opposition politicians currently lacks the capacity to challenge a sitting president of the calibre and competence of Asiwaju Bola Ahmed Tinubu. With firm conviction, we declare that the South-East will no longer be shackled to ineffective opposition, particularly under the leadership of Mr Peter Obi, whose tenure has failed to fulfil the promises made to our people.

 

“On that landmark day, 23 May 2025, during President Tinubu’s scheduled visit, we expect the collective presence of all South-East governors—irrespective of their political affiliations—representing the APC, PDP, LP, and APGA. This unprecedented gathering will not only cement our endorsement of President Tinubu as the South-East’s sole candidate but also symbolise a historic transition from a decade of unproductive opposition to one of constructive national integration.

 

“We urge all stakeholders and citizens of the South-East to wholeheartedly embrace this transformative journey, uniting our voices and actions to ensure that Ndigbo continue to play a central role in Nigeria’s national discourse. This is more than a political endorsement; it is a clarion call for renewed commitment, resilience, and aspiration to uplift our region and the nation at large.”
